Symmetrical Components for Three Phase Power Analysis Course Overview This course on Symmetrical Components for Three Phase Power Analysis provides a comprehensive introduction to a fundamental technique used in electrical power engineering. Learners will explore how symmetrical components simplify the analysis of unbalanced three-phase power systems, enhancing their ability to diagnose and solve complex electrical faults. The course offers clear explanations of key concepts such as positive, negative, and zero sequence components, as well as the mathematical tools required to apply them effectively. By completing this course, participants will gain valuable skills that improve their understanding of power system behaviour, enabling more accurate system design, fault analysis, and operational decision-making. This knowledge is essential for engineers, technicians, and students engaged in power system analysis and maintenance. Course Description This detailed course delves into the principles and applications of symmetrical components within three-phase power systems. Starting with an introduction to the historical background and theoretical framework, learners will examine the mathematical derivation and significance of symmetrical components. Key topics include the definition and roles of the positive, negative, and zero sequence components, the “a” operator used in transformations, and the synthesis equations that enable conversion between phase and sequence quantities. The course also emphasises problem-solving techniques through a variety of illustrative examples, fostering a thorough understanding of how symmetrical components aid in analysing unbalanced loads and fault conditions. Learners will develop the ability to interpret and manage three-phase system data with greater precision, a crucial skill for careers in electrical engineering and power system operation.
